Dutch household assets shrank 10% to an average of €27,000 between January 2011 and January 2012, the national statistics office CBS said on Wednesday. In 2008, before the crisis began, average household assets totalled €47,000.
The drop is largely due to the fall in house prices. Some 57% of Dutch households own their own home, the CBS said. Read more.
